CSS3是一種用于網(wǎng)頁(yè)設(shè)計(jì)的技術(shù),提供了許多用于控制網(wǎng)頁(yè)外觀和行為的強(qiáng)大工具。其中,動(dòng)態(tài)展示搜索框是CSS3中一種強(qiáng)大的功能,可以通過簡(jiǎn)單的編寫代碼來創(chuàng)建交互式搜索框。
動(dòng)態(tài)展示搜索框可以通過在HTML中添加CSS樣式來實(shí)現(xiàn)。在CSS中,可以使用`input[type="search"]`元素來創(chuàng)建一個(gè)搜索框,并通過CSS的樣式來對(duì)其進(jìn)行控制。例如,可以設(shè)置搜索框的字體大小、顏色、背景顏色等屬性。
CSS3還提供了許多其他工具,可以幫助創(chuàng)建交互式搜索框。例如,可以使用CSS3的`select`元素來創(chuàng)建一個(gè)選擇器,讓用戶可以選擇搜索關(guān)鍵詞。還可以使用CSS3的`input[type="button"]`元素來創(chuàng)建一個(gè)按鈕,用于觸發(fā)搜索。
要?jiǎng)討B(tài)展示搜索框,需要在HTML中添加一個(gè)`input[type="search"]`元素,并使用CSS對(duì)其進(jìn)行樣式控制。例如,可以使用以下代碼來創(chuàng)建一個(gè)紅色背景上的搜索框:
input[type="search"] {
background-color: #ff0000;
color: #fff;
padding: 10px;
border: none;
border-radius: 5px;
width: 100%;
在上面的代碼中,`background-color`屬性設(shè)置為紅色,`color`屬性設(shè)置為白色,`padding`屬性設(shè)置為10px,`border`屬性設(shè)置為0,`border-radius`屬性設(shè)置為5px,`width`屬性設(shè)置為100%。這些屬性控制了搜索框的外觀和行為。
除了`input[type="search"]`元素外,還可以使用其他CSS屬性來控制搜索框的行為。例如,可以使用`max-width`屬性來限制搜索框的寬度,使用`placeholder`屬性來顯示搜索提示,使用`text-align`屬性來調(diào)整搜索框的文本位置等。
通過使用CSS3的動(dòng)態(tài)展示搜索框功能,可以創(chuàng)建交互式搜索框,讓用戶可以輕松地搜索信息。此外,CSS3還提供了許多其他工具,可以幫助創(chuàng)建不同類型的搜索框,滿足不同的需求。